About Us: We are a family of four organizations (Proscape Landscaping, Austin Pool Pros, a strategic consulting firm, and a non-profit foundation) based in Austin, TX. While we are in the business of cutting grass and cleaning pools, these businesses are simply the vehicle for a larger vision.
We exist to generate resources that fund non-profit work enabling human flourishing. We are seeking top-tier talent who thrives on working hard and delivering exceptional results. The Role: We are looking for a high-capacity operational finance leader to centralize and professionalize the financial operations of our four entities. We have a "minion" for data entry and an Owner who acts as the Controller (signing checks and making high-level capital allocation decisions). We need the bridge between the two: a leader who ensures our data is flawless, our systems are unified, and our cash flow forecasting is reality-based.
You will not just be "keeping the books"; you will be building the "financial engine" that powers our mission.
The Mission: Your goal is to give the owners total confidence in the numbers across all organizations. We do not want to hold a weekly meeting to "review the numbers." We want a weekly email that is so accurate we can run the businesses off it without asking a single question.
Key Responsibilities:
Multi-Entity Command: Implement and maintain a unified chart of accounts and standard operating procedures (SOPs) across all 4 entities (3 for-profit, 1 non-profit).
Own the 13-Week Cash Flow: You will own the master cash flow model for the group. You must be able to forecast liquidity needs for capital-intensive projects (pools/landscaping) vs. the steady state of the consulting firm.
The "Weekly Truth" Report: Every Friday, you will deliver a consolidated report containing:
13-Week Cash Flow vs. Actuals.
Aged AR with an action plan for collections.
Budget vs. Actuals for the month.
Manage the Team: Oversee the Accounting Assistant to ensure AP/AR, COIs, and W9s are processed timely and accurately.
Revenue Logic & Job Costing: Deeply understand our recurring maintenance contracts and construction milestones. Ensure revenue is recognized correctly in accordance with our contracts.
Non-Profit Compliance: Ensure the non-profit’s books are audit-ready and compliant with specific fund accounting standards.
Process Enforcement: The Owner releases the funds, but you ensure the request is valid before it gets to him.

Requirements:
US GAAP Expertise: Must have 5+ Years US GAAP Experience. You must have significant experience managing books for US companies. You understand the difference between Cash and Accrual basis and how to handle US construction revenue recognition.
Schedule: You must be available to work during US Central Time (CST) business hours to collaborate with the owners and operations team.
Communication: Flawless written and spoken English is non-negotiable. You must be comfortable pushing back and asking clarifying questions.
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or Finance.
5+ years of experience in accounting, with specific experience managing multiple entities simultaneously.
Tools: We use Hubstaff for all remote team members to track time and activity. We love this tool because it generates awesome data for you (think of it like a "Fitbit for your work"), helping you optimize your productivity while ensuring transparency across the organization.
Experience with Job Costing (construction/service) and Non-Profit accounting is highly preferred.
Tech Stack: Expert in QuickBooks Online, Google Spreadsheets (Modeling), and integrations (Aspire/Gusto).
